Final Evaluation for Experiment Germany volunteers – March 2019

Final Evaluation for Experiment Germany volunteers – March 2019

FSL-India’s LTV Kundapur team organised the Final-Evaluation for our Long Term Volunteers from Experiment Germany. The programme was held for 1 day, on 25th March 2019. In total, 8 volunteers from EG took part in this evaluation. The FE was organised at FSL-India’s Centre for Experiential Living. Through the FE, the LTV-Kundapur team collected the volunteers’ final feedback and impact study details about their project, host family and their intercultural experience.
